Explorer’s Guide Online (EGO), America’s premier online captain’s licensing program, is pleased to announce its partnership with the National Professional Anglers Association (NPAA) for the 2021 season. EGO is beyond excited to work with anglers, on-the-water educators, guides, and other professionals as they earn their maritime licenses.

A captain’s license is required for any mariner carrying “passengers-for-hire.” Captain Bobby Carsey, the owner of EGO, is a former Coast Guard Commanding Officer and knows just how crucial proper licensing is to the maritime industry. When discussing the importance of licenses, Captain Bobby said, “Licensed mariners are responsible mariners, and the EGO crew strives to provide the best licensing training possible.” As such, EGO’s licensing programs have been reviewed and approved by the National Maritime Center.

Pat Neu, NPAA Executive Director, said, “We are very excited to welcome EGO as a new NPAA Supporting Partner for 2021. Many of our members are guides, charter captains, and angling professionals who are compensated for their time on the water and who operate on waters where they need their mariner credentials. Having EGO as a partner with our association will allow our members to utilize EGO’s online program to gain the knowledge they need to earn those essential credentials. This partnership is another example of how an NPAA Partnership and an NPAA Membership can help to connect our partners with our members to benefit each.”
